The fifth of 26 playgrounds dedicated to the victims of the Sandy Hook School shooting was the site of a groundbreaking ceremony Saturday at Longbrook Park in Stratford.

This playscape is for teacher Victoria Soto who loved flamingos and Christmas and children. The playground is a collaboration of efforts headed up by The Sandy Ground Project, an organization that is building playgrounds across the East Coast in honor of the Sandy Hook victims.

Playgrounds have already been completed in Westport, in honor of Dylan Hockey, in Ansonia, for Catherine Hubbard, in Sea Bright, N.J. for Anne Marie Murphy, and in Union Beach, N.J for Jack Pinto.
